Visually grasp the schedule
--Are there any points you like about the Creators Diary?
"The bellows are helpful. When deciding on a schedule, you can expand it to get a bird's-eye view of the schedule, and at first glance, it's empty so you can do it, and you can expand it at meetings."
--From a bird's-eye view, it's obvious that the schedule is open.
"I'm the type that is easier to get into my head visually, so the schedule book feels like a figure, and I understand it visually as if there is time because it is blank.I wonder if there is so much until the deadline, or if I'm so rested. This diary can be grasped at a glance
-I see.It seems that the judgment will be quicker if you catch it visually.
"I feel that things like this horizontal axis and vertical axis naturally come into my head."
-Do you always think vertically with the horizontal flow in your head?
"is that so"
--- If you have been using it for 11 years, you will naturally be able to think that way. Is there anything you have devised to get a visual idea of your schedule?
"I try to check the tasks that have been completed.Check your schedule for this week at the beginning of the week and mark the schedules that are close to the deadline to stand out. "
--What does color coding mean?
"The parts I use in the main (project column below) are color-coded for easy understanding, but the others are just written with what I have at that time.There are some things that are not easy to use unless you devise a notebook, but since this has different roles for the top and bottom, it is good to understand it immediately even if you write it roughly like me.I'm sure there are people who enjoy the ingenuity, but for me it's better to write it and understand it. Inspiration comes from time with children and greed books
--Where did Yoshii-san's creative ideas and inspiration come from?
"I still like old printed matter, and there are materials like that, and after moving here, I sometimes come up with ideas in the nature while taking a walk."
--- It's a place where nature is really abundant, isn't it? Then, spending time playing with your child in the park is also a search for ideas.
"That's right. Finding mushrooms and picking up acorns."
-Is the time for ideas for work included in what you do?
"Yes, it is included.When I draw a picture, I first collect the materials necessary to draw the picture and then draw it, but the strange things that came out by image search at that time are also inspiration.
For a while, I've been watching Tumblr every day, collecting what I want and what I like. That's why the illustrations are greedy and the essence of that (laughs). "

-I like the name Greedy Book (laughs)
"It's a book like a lump of greed, and you can't get everything you wrote, and you may get less than 10% of the total. Put this in your bag and go shopping. And even if there is something I want a little, there are still more things I want more than this, so this has the effect of suppressing myself as if I do not have to buy it yet (laugh) "
-I see.It's a notebook to spit out your own desires.
"I also write about enthusiasm. I write" I don't buy when I'm impatient "(laughs)."
--- I also wanted to write a greedy book.
"It's good, writing it will eliminate the sickness. I highly recommend it."
